Warde is 2-8 against Stamford since May of 2016 but they'll have a chance to close the gap a little bit on Friday. The Warde Mustangs will head out on the road to take on the Stamford Black Knights at 4:00 p.m. Warde will be strutting in after a win while Stamford will be coming in after a defeat.
Warde's pitching crew heads into the match hoping to repeat the dominance they displayed on Monday. They came out on top against Darien by a score of 3-0.
Meanwhile, after soaring to 13 runs the game before, Stamford was a bit more limited in their contest on Wednesday. They lost 8-1 to Ludlowe. Stamford has struggled against Ludlowe recently, as their matchup on Wednesday was their seventh consecutive lost matchup.
Warde's victory bumped their record up to 5-9. As for Stamford, their loss dropped their record down to 4-7.
